Best Car Parts in South Granville

Word of Mouth Car Parts in South Granville receive an average rating of 4.4 based off 18 reviews.
0.0 0 reviews    ·    Auburn NSW ·     (Wednesday:  8:30am–5pm)  
0.0 0 reviews    ·    Auburn NSW ·     (Wednesday:  08:00 AM - 05:0...)  
0.0 0 reviews    ·    Granville NSW ·     (Wednesday:  9:00 am to 5:00 pm)